How Much Does Reconstruction of foot joints and toes Cost in Poland?

Reconstruction of foot joints and toes in Poland typically costs from $7,500 to $12,500. The final price depends on surgical complexity, the choice of implants, and the specific clinic location. Major medical hubs include Warsaw, Jelenia Góra, and Rzeszów. In the US, similar procedures cost around $32,500 on average. Poland offers savings of around 69%. Most clinics include diagnostics, anesthesia, and initial physiotherapy.

  • Complete joint reconstruction: Typically starts around 20-30% higher than minor corrective surgeries.
  • Bunion correction (Hallux Valgus): Corrective procedures using modern implant methods generally command a premium.
  • Ankle joint replacement: Usually represents the highest price tier among foot reconstruction procedures.
  • Toe bone fixation: Standard fracture repairs or osteophyte removals offer the most budget-friendly surgical options.
